Analysis of the relationship between bacterial adherence and extracellular production of mannose, galactose, glucose and ribose in Staphylococcus epidermidis and Staphylococcus hominis.

Abstract

Gas-liquid chromatography-mass spectrometry was used to analyze the extracellular extracts of 108 coagulase-negative staphylococcal strains for the presence of mannose, galactose, glucose and ribose, in order to determine whether production of these four monosaccharides, regarded as potential staphylococcal slime components, was associated with the adherence capacity of the individuals strains. A total of 90 Staphylococcus epidermidis and 18 Staphylococcus hominis strains were studied. Using the quantitative spectrophotometric assay, 21 Staphylococcus epidermidis strains were classified as strongly adherent, 12 as moderately adherent, 11 as weakly adherent, and 46 as nonadherent. All 18 Staphylococcus hominis strains were nonadherent. Mannose, galactose, glucose and ribose were detected as the main monosaccharide components in the extracellular extracts of all strains examined. Moreover, the mean relative concentrations of these monosaccharides were essentially the same for the different adherence phenotypes within the species Staphylococcus epidermidis. These results showed that there was no causal connection between the adherence of coagulase-negative staphylococci and the extracellular production of any of the four monosaccharides analyzed.

摘要

采用气-液色谱-质谱联用技术分析108株凝固酶阴性葡萄球菌菌株的细胞外提取物中甘露糖、半乳糖、葡萄糖和核糖的存在情况,以确定这四种被视为潜在葡萄球菌黏液成分的单糖的产生是否与各菌株的黏附能力相关。共研究了90株表皮葡萄球菌和18株人葡萄球菌菌株。使用定量分光光度法测定,21株表皮葡萄球菌菌株被分类为强黏附性,12株为中度黏附性,11株为弱黏附性, 46株为非黏附性。所有18株人葡萄球菌菌株均为非黏附性。在所检测的所有菌株的细胞外提取物中,甘露糖、半乳糖、葡萄糖和核糖被检测为主要的单糖成分。此外,在表皮葡萄球菌种内,这些单糖的平均相对浓度对于不同的黏附表型基本相同。这些结果表明,凝固酶阴性葡萄球菌的黏附与所分析四种单糖中任何一种的细胞外产生之间没有因果关系。
